Transaction 60c33162868919ebde830dc07d21e0cde113260fa15b62a809ca736223913dbb
1 Input
1 Output
-
60c33162868919ebde830dc07d21e0cde113260fa15b62a809ca736223913dbb:0
- value
- 4086247
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d71af4b8f9a87cd0631a7918c2f5ba170e7d2127 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LcNaBBk3t9v9eQzRzdnk6KYGV1KXbTvWC